Photometric and Spectroscopic Investigations of Three Large Amplitude Contact Binaries
Abstract We performed photometric and spectroscopic studies of three large amplitude contact binaries: NSVS 2418361, ATLAS J057.1170+31.2384, and NSVS 7377875. The amplitudes of these three systems’ light curves are more than 0.7 mag. We analyzed the light curves using the Wilson–Devinney code to yield physical parameters.

Modeling of Two Low-amplitude Radially Pulsating δ Scuti Stars: KIC 12602250 and KIC 5768203
In this research, we conducted systematic photometric, spectroscopic, and theoretical modeling analyses of two δ Scuti stars—KIC 12602250 and KIC 5768203—that pulsate only in radial modes.
